To put it simply, we are a small group of bloggers who get together (online) on the last Friday of each month to post about that month's selection. For the month of March, we kicked things off with Tennessee Williams's The Night of the Iguana. Here are our upcoming attractions:

April: Life, A User's Manual by Georges Perec
May: Tender Morsels by Margo Lanagan
June: Moo Pak by Gabriel Josipovici
July: A Personal Matter by Kenzaburo Oe
August: In the American Grain by William Carlos Williams
September: Santa Evita by Tomás Eloy Martínez
October: Old School by Tobias Wolff
November: Vilnius Poker by Ričardas Gavelis
December: Clandestine in Chile: The Adventures of Miguel Littin by Gabriel García Márquez

Note all the great international works!
